Microwave Assisted Attractive and Rapid Process for Synthesis of Octahydroquinazolinone in Aqueous Hydrotropic Solutions

摘要

We demonstrate here the synthesis of octahydroquinazolinone derivatives through one-pot, three-component condensation reactions of various aryl aldehydes, with a dimedone and urea in 50 % aqueous hydrotropic solution (Sodium p-Toluene Sulfonate) under microwave irradiation. This method exhibits efficient and environmentally benign methodology with simple reaction workup for the rapid synthesis of library of octahydroquinazolinones. Moreover, the reaction medium can be easily separated from the product and subsequently reused many times. The present method is of great interest in the context of environmentally greener and safer processes.
